It's How You Say It
Term | Definition |
---|---|
acclaim | to praise with enthusiasm |
accolade | an honor or praise |
acquaint | to make aware of; make known |
ambiguous | having two or more possible meanings |
approval | a good opinion; consent |
attitude | a feeling or a state of mind |
banter | light or playful remarks; teasing |
cajole | to persuade with flattery |
chastise | to criticize strongly |
confide | to discuss private matters or secrets |
criticism | an evaluation or judgement |
defer | to yield to the opinion of someone else; to give in |
dialogue | conversation between two or more people |
embellish | to add made-up details |
enrage | to make very angry |
fabricate | to make up; to invent |
flippant | humorous in a slightly disrespectful way |
harangue | an overly long, very passionate speech |
refer | to send or direct someone to |
vehement | showing strong feeling |
